Lemon Frog Cake Recipe

Ingredients with Measurements:
- 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 tsp baking powder
- 1/2 tsp baking soda
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 2 large eggs
- 1/2 cup buttermilk
- 1/4 cup fresh lemon juice
- 1 tbsp lemon zest
- Green food coloring
- Lemon frosting
- Candy eyes
- Chocolate chips

Special equipment needed:
- 9-inch round cake pan
- Electric mixer
- Piping bag with round tip

Step-by-step instructions:

1. Preheat the oven to 350°F. Grease and flour a 9-inch round cake pan.

2. In a medium bowl, whisk together fl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t.

3. In a large bowl, beat butter and sugar with an electric mixer until light and fluffy.

4. Add eggs one at a time, beating well after each addition.

5. Gradually add the flour mixture to the butter mixture, alternating with buttermilk and lemon juice.

6. Stir in lemon zest and green food coloring until the batter is a light green color.

7. Pour the batter into the prepared pan and bake for 25-30 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.

8. Let the cake cool completely before frosting.

9. To make the frog eyes, melt chocolate chips in a microwave-safe bowl in 30-second intervals, stirring in between until smooth. Place candy eyes on a parchment paper-lined baking sheet and use a piping bag with a round tip to pipe melted chocolate onto the eyes to create pupils.

10. Frost the cake with lemon frosting and place the candy eyes on top.

11. Use a piping bag with a round tip to pipe frog legs onto the cake with green frosting.

12. Serve and enjoy!
